The Real Risks of a Mouse Infestation
At first glance, you might think mice are harmless. After all, they’re small, right? But don’t let their size fool you. A mouse infestation can:
- Contaminate Your Food: Mice love to nibble on pantry staples like cereal, rice, and snacks. The bad news? They also leave behind bacteria and droppings, making your food unsafe to eat.
- Spread Disease: Mice can carry various diseases, such as Hantavirus and salmonella. And while you won’t see them wearing a little "Warning: Contagious" sign, their droppings, urine, and saliva can transmit serious health risks.
- Damage Property: Mice have teeth that never stop growing, so they chew constantly – on wires, furniture, walls, you name it. This gnawing habit can result in electrical fires or costly repairs.
How Do You Know You Have Mice?
Mice are sneaky little guys. They won’t announce their arrival with a drumroll – they’ll quietly set up shop in the dark corners of your home, undetected for as long as possible. So, how do you know you have a problem?
- Droppings: Mouse droppings are tiny, dark, and shaped like rice grains. If you start seeing them around food storage areas, it’s time to raise the red flag.
- Noises in the Night: Mice are nocturnal, meaning they do most of their mischief while you’re fast asleep. If you hear scurrying sounds in your walls or ceiling at night, you’re likely hosting some unwanted guests.
- Gnaw Marks: If you spot tiny gnaw marks on food packaging, furniture, or electrical wires, you’ve got a mouse problem.
- Musky Odor: A house that has mice often develops a musky smell. Trust us, it’s not a pleasant addition to your home’s ambiance.
Prevention is Key
They say prevention is better than cure – and when it comes to mice, that’s especially true. Here are some easy steps you can take to keep these furry freeloaders from entering your home:
- Seal Entry Points: Mice can slip through holes as small as a dime. Go on a mouse-sized tour of your home and seal any potential entry points with steel wool or caulk.
- Store Food Properly: Mice love your pantry as much as you do. Store food in airtight containers and clean up crumbs or spills immediately.
- Declutter: Mice love clutter because it provides perfect hiding spots. Keep your home tidy, especially in attics, basements, and garages.
- Take Out the Trash: Mice are opportunists, and garbage is a treasure trove of snacks for them. Keep trash in sealed bins and take it out regularly.
